Coca-Cola Football League One
Saturday, March 5, 2005

Swindon Town AFC Bournemouth

HT: 0-1 W.Elliott (1'), J.Hayter (56'), M.Mills (74')
Attendance:  8,275 (1,208 away fans)   Referee:  E. Evans



 
After six games undefeated, Swindon go into the game with the Cherries full of confidence, knowing that a win would see the Town leapfrog them and into the play-off positions. Billed as the most important game of the season, the Town don't turn up, and are humbled on their own ground by three goals to nil.
